If your porch, patio, or front steps could use something cuter than another basic planter, Target has an adorable wagon-shaped option on sale right now. The Costway Wooden Wagon Planter comes in three colors: brown, green, and red, with the green version marked down to the lowest price at $38 (originally $76). The brown option is on sale for $40 (down from $90), while the red is the best deal at 68% off at $40 (down from $120).

The planter measures 24.5 inches long by 13.5 inches wide by 24 inches high and weighs 5.5 pounds. It’s made from fir wood and metal, with a freestanding design, a long front handle, and four metal wheels. It has a 33-pound weight capacity and includes one garden bed. It’s also important to note that it doesn’t have drainage holes, so you may want to use it for potted plants or add your own drainage if you plan to plant directly in it.

It can hold flowers, herbs, succulents, faux stems, seasonal decor, or a mix of smaller pots. The wagon shape gives it a more unique look than a standard rectangular planter, especially near a front door, on a balcony, or in a garden corner. And since it’s on wheels and under six pounds before plants are added, it’s also much easier to shift around than a larger raised bed.

Shoppers have called the wagon “very beautiful” and “perfect for plant lovers.” “It’s practical for holding plants and adds a charming, rustic vibe to my outdoor space,” one person wrote, while another called it “so cute” and “very easy to put together.”

The brown color is the most classic option if your porch already has wood tones or a farmhouse-style setup. The green style would look cute with herb, terracotta pots, or a small cottage garden arrangement. The red shade has a more vintage garden feel and would be especially fun for summer flowers, fall mums, or holiday greenery later in the year.
